Marsh Risk accelerates cyber business interruption claims payments for clients

New York | June 15, 2026

Marsh Risk, a business of Marsh (NYSE: MRSH) and the world’s leading insurance broker and risk advisor, today announced the launch of a cyber policy endorsement framework designed to accelerate clients access to funds following a cyber incident.

Using the framework, Marsh has successfully negotiated bespoke accelerated payment endorsements with leading cyber insurers AIG, Beazley, Canopius, CFC, and QBE. Marsh has also incorporated new policy language into its proprietary primary cyber products, including Cyber CAT, and is actively working to expand carrier participation and extend the framework to additional markets globally.

The framework establishes a clear, negotiated pathway for advance and interim payments and enables insurers to pay approved incident‑response firms directly, so clients don’t have to front early recovery costs during a crisis. It also mandates interim payments for undisputed business interruption (BI) losses and sets a standardized, prioritized evidence package to shorten insurer review times and align expectations among policyholders, brokers, and insurers. The policy language clarifies when response costs and BI losses are eligible, reducing ambiguity that often slows settlements. 

“Settling cyber business interruption claims can be a protracted, documentation-heavy process,” said Greg Eskins, Global Cyber Product Leader, Marsh Risk. “Our framework is aimed squarely at the operational and financial realities our clients face when they are trying to recover from a cyber incident. By minimizing our clients’ out-of-pocket expenses, getting money into their hands sooner, and by reducing complexity regarding the documentation insurers need, we help clients focus on recovery, not paperwork.”
